Abstract
Telemedicine, the use of telecommunications technology to deliver healthcare services remotely, has gained significant attention in recent years for its potential to improve access to care and healthcare delivery efficiency. This research project explores the implementation of telemedicine in pediatric care and its impact on healthcare delivery and patient outcomes. The study begins with an in-depth examination of the background of telemedicine in pediatric care, highlighting the growing importance of technology in healthcare delivery. It addresses the problem statement concerning the challenges and opportunities associated with implementing telemedicine in pediatric settings. The objectives of the study are to evaluate the effectiveness of telemedicine in improving access to care for pediatric patients, enhancing healthcare delivery efficiency, and assessing its impact on patient outcomes. The research methodology involves a comprehensive literature review, analyzing existing studies and reports on telemedicine in pediatric care. The review covers various aspects of telemedicine implementation, including technology platforms, communication systems, regulatory considerations, and patient acceptance. The study also includes an assessment of the methodologies used in previous research to evaluate the impact of telemedicine on healthcare delivery and patient outcomes. The findings from the research highlight the benefits of telemedicine in pediatric care, such as increased access to specialized care, reduced healthcare costs, and improved patient satisfaction. The discussion delves into the challenges of implementing telemedicine, including technology infrastructure requirements, regulatory barriers, and concerns about data security and patient privacy. The study also explores the potential limitations of telemedicine in pediatric care, such as limitations in physical examinations and the need for in-person follow-up care. In conclusion, this research project emphasizes the significance of telemedicine in transforming pediatric care delivery and improving patient outcomes. The study underscores the importance of addressing the challenges associated with telemedicine implementation to maximize its benefits for pediatric patients and healthcare providers. The research findings provide valuable insights for healthcare policymakers, providers, and technology developers seeking to enhance pediatric care delivery through telemedicine. Project Overview

The project topic "Implementation of Telemedicine in Pediatric Care: Impact on Healthcare Delivery and Patient Outcomes" focuses on the integration of telemedicine technologies in the field of pediatric care and its implications for healthcare delivery and patient outcomes. Telemedicine, the remote delivery of healthcare services using telecommunication technologies, has gained significant prominence in recent years due to its potential to overcome geographical barriers, improve access to care, and enhance healthcare efficiency. In the context of pediatric care, the utilization of telemedicine presents unique opportunities and challenges that warrant further exploration and analysis. The primary objective of this research is to investigate how the implementation of telemedicine in pediatric care settings influences healthcare delivery practices and patient outcomes. By leveraging telecommunication technologies such as video conferencing, remote monitoring devices, and secure messaging platforms, healthcare providers can deliver timely and effective care to pediatric patients, particularly in underserved or remote areas. This study seeks to evaluate the impact of telemedicine interventions on various aspects of pediatric care, including access to specialized services, continuity of care, patient satisfaction, and clinical outcomes. Key areas of focus in this research include assessing the effectiveness of telemedicine in facilitating timely consultations with pediatric specialists, monitoring pediatric patients with chronic conditions remotely, and improving communication between healthcare providers and caregivers. Additionally, the study will examine the challenges and limitations associated with the implementation of telemedicine in pediatric care, such as technological barriers, regulatory issues, and privacy concerns. By conducting a comprehensive analysis of the current state of telemedicine in pediatric care, this research aims to provide insights that can inform policy decisions, clinical practices, and future research directions in this rapidly evolving field. Overall, the project on the "Implementation of Telemedicine in Pediatric Care: Impact on Healthcare Delivery and Patient Outcomes" seeks to contribute to the growing body of knowledge on telemedicine applications in pediatric healthcare. Through a thorough examination of the benefits, challenges, and implications of integrating telemedicine into pediatric care settings, this research aims to enhance our understanding of how technology-enabled healthcare delivery models can improve access to care, enhance patient outcomes, and ultimately transform the delivery of pediatric healthcare services.
